Zara Johnson to retire after 30 years with Cicero’s Development Corp.

Zara Johnson, who first joined Plainfield, Illinois-based Cicero’s Development in 1989 as office manager, will be retiring after 30 years with the company. Johnson will continue to share her talents at Cicero’s Development on the part-time basis, contributing in the areas of marketing, administration and accounting, to support her transition.

“Zara is respected and admired both inside our company and with our clients. Her exemplary work ethic, achievements and personal integrity have been admired throughout her distinguished career,” said Sam Cicero, president of Cicero’s Development Corp. “Zara personifies customer service which is rooted in her knowledge of commercial property renovation and business administration, in addition to her unwavering focus on details that earned her respect from clients, fellow employees and contractors.”

A vital team player that has helped to build Cicero’s Development’s business, Johnson most recently served as director of business development and under her tenure has been at the forefront of meeting the company’s evolving technology needs. In addition, she has successfully led the company’s human resources, accounts receivable and payable functions, the benefits program and critical elements of the safety program.

In her retirement, Johnson plans to spend more time with her family. She is also a breast cancer survivor, and will continue in her retirement to work in the community, speaking to other women about cancer screenings and offering emotional support to those who are battling this disease.
